House Hartmannswiller (68)
Nestled at the foot of the Vosges mountains, in the heart of a preserved natural environment, this exceptional estate of 3.5 hectares, on which two hundred-year-old trees flourish, is located in the immediate vicinity of the historic site of Vieil Armand. It is composed of several buildings including a 720 m² castle built in 1322, which includes numerous elements classified as Historic Monuments. A true witness to the different eras it has passed through, the castle has a vast main entrance adorned with ashlars and exposed beams that leads to the listed chapel as well as the vaulted cellar. A spiral stairway dating from 1562 leads to the upper floor which houses the main living rooms spanning 360 m² (3,767 sq ft). It comprises a bathroom, a kitchen and six vast rooms where massive parquet flooring, fireplaces and mouldings bear witness to a rich past. The second and top floor has the same surface area and now only has attic space. A 160 m² (1,615 sq ft) annexe, an old farmhouse, a 120 m² (1,292 sq ft) house, as well as a 112 m² (1,184 sq ft) barn and its 206 m² (2,967 sq ft) stable are also set in the heart of this wooded parklands, which are maintained with the greatest care. House Colmar (68)
A late-19th-century mansion nestled in the beautiful city of Colmar, opposite the Court of Appeal. Two wrought-iron gates open into driveways that lead to the mansion’s side entrances. The building has a central section that is set back and two wings that are slightly higher than the latter, forming a symmetrical layout. The west driveway also leads to a triple garage at the back of the grounds and a tree-dotted garden that enjoys privacy. This back garden lies at a lower level than the front of the property. The mansion was built at the end of the 19th century and redesigned from the 1960s. It has three floors, a basement and a loft space in each of its two protruding wings. Its north-facing facade is made of stone and rendered with a pale pink coating. It has six bays and exposed quoins and windows surrounds of dressed stone. The windows are tall and rectangular, except on the top floor of the central section, where dormers that are smaller and plainer punctuate this section’s lower mansard roof slope. The windows are all positioned evenly and symmetrically. A balcony adorned with a splendid wrought-iron balustrade runs along the first floor of the central section. Two identical hipped slate roofs crown the east and west wings. At the back, a garden-facing gabled dormer adorns the roof of each wing. The central section’s roof has a two-part mansard slope on its street side and a single slope on its garden side. On the mansion’s different sides, a cornice underlines the roof, which overhangs the walls only slightly. Behind, on the south side, outdoor steps lead from the raised ground floor down to the garden.

House Mulhouse (68)
Offices in an elegant 19th-century edifice in Mulhouse city centre, opposite a park. The edifice was built at the end of the 19th century. It has five floors, the top two of which are in the building’s grand mansard roof of slate and zinc. A tree-dotted garden separates it from a neighbouring property. The walls of its base course are made of pink sandstone from the nearby Vosges mountains. The two main elevations face respectively north, on the street Rue de la Sinne, and south-west, on the street Rue Lamartine. They are punctuated with seven bays adorned with pilasters and finely sculpted surrounds. A corner tower joins these two elevations together. An adjoining two-floor section extends the edifice towards the garden. The building’s thick main door of finely sculpted wood beneath a glazed fanlight leads to a few stairs inside that take you up to the entrance hall. This hallway connects to the offices, the garden, a cellar, a lavatory and the upper floors via a timber spiral staircase. The offices are on the ground floor. From outside, this level stands out from the upper floors for its ornamental horizontal grooves and its tall windows adorned with pear-shaped balusters beneath their sills. The layout of the rooms is practical: each office can be reached from the communal areas. A consulting firm has been renting these offices since 2001.
